I started a thread about the image of performance boaters on BoaterEd.com last year, and this was by far the most common complaint. Although most people admitted they liked the sound most of the time, it can be pretty offensive if you're anchored up in a "quiet" cove or enjoying a tall cool one at the end of the day. I agree - If you have Captains Call - use it.
I wouldn't advocate going to rec.boats and flaming the guy - just let him know that you (we) do what we can to be responsible boaters by making sure we meet each state's particular requirements. If you don't know what your state law is, go to Corsaperf.com - they have them all listed: http://www.corsaperf.com/mlaws.htm
